Opinion: As the Supreme Court Reviews Its Decision On Imo Governorship Election, By Chidi Odinkalu

Nigeria’s experiment in elective governance can hardly survive by choosing to replace INEC’s arbitrariness with judicial imponderability. This is why the sitting of the Court on Tuesday matters. In 2008, the Supreme Court scorned the notion of deciding election disputes based on principles as “vague, nebulous and large.” On 18 February, it can correct that…

The essential facts in the Imo State governorship judgment are reasonably well known now but need recapping nevertheless. The state comprises 27 local government areas, 305 electoral wards and 3,523 polling units. In the 2019 governorship election, the Independent National Electoral Commission cancelled the results from 252 polling units because of violence, excluded results from another 388 units and announced outcomes on the basis of the collation of results from 2,883 polling units.

Hope Uzodinma claimed that he had scored 213,695 votes from the 388 polling units which were excluded, while Mr. Ihedioha, according to his results, scored only 1,903. His argument was that by adding these votes to his original score, he would have emerged winner. To establish his claim, Mr. Uzodinma presented his version of results through a deputy commissioner of Police, who was not employed by the INEC. The deputy commissioner claimed the results were those issued by INEC.

There were three issues that fell to be decided in this matter. The first was whether the evidence of the deputy commissioner of Police was admissible. The Supreme Court decided that it was. That is not dispositive, so should not detain us unduly.
